SINGAPORE: Singapore has set a new world record for having the largest rally of badminton.
Over 600 people turned up with their racquets on Saturday morning for the attempt. One by one, they each took a shot at keeping the shuttlecock in the air.
Singapore’s national players Ronald Susilo and Kendrick Lee also turned up. In the end, 96 people managed to keep a rally going non—stop, and in the process, a new Guinness World Record was set.
The record attempt was held as part of the Aviva Open which will take place in June
